Thus has Kosovo Police spokesman for the Mitrovica region Veton Elshani confirmed.
We didn't have any incidents last night, but today the situation is quiet”, he said.
A day earlier, in the north police have discovered a large quantity of weapons in a Serbia license vehicle.
“Thanks to the intense commitment of the Kosovo Police specialised units and the information/intelligence accepted, today a Belgrade license plate car, about 100m from the Zvecan municipality, in which large quantities of weapons, explosives and ammunition, included Zola, Osa, explosives, significant quantities of ammunition, shock-bomba, military uniforms and bag”, the Police report said.
In the announcement made by police, it is stressed that all these tools were intended and serve for the realisation of terrorist attacks on citizens and institutions of the Republic of Kosovo.
“This is also a next testimony that Serbia through such groups and organisations aims to destabilise our country”.
Tensions in the north have taken place since the day young Albanian mayors took office. Local Serbs have staged violent protests, where many KFOR soldiers, policemen, journalists and cameramen have been injured.
